Предоставление ограниченного выпуска приложения для iOS - PullRequest
0 голосов
/ 10 октября 2011

Я разрабатываю приложение, которое будет иметь две версии: одну в магазине приложений и ограниченную версию, которая будет разыграна в конкурсе одному победителю.У меня вопрос, как мне предоставить приложение, которое можно раздать только одному человеку?Я предполагаю, что мне нужен их UDID, и я должен отправить им специальный профиль для обеспечения распространения;но значит ли это, что мне придется продолжать посылать им новые профили каждый раз, когда истекает срок его действия?

Какой лучший способ сделать это?

Спасибо,

chmod

Ответы [ 2 ]

1 голос
/ 10 октября 2011

Срок действия специальных сертификатов распространения истекает.Если вы не хотите отдавать ограниченное по времени приложение (срок действия Ad Hoc), лучшим вариантом может быть подарить приложение на учетную запись победителя в iTunes, что обойдется разработчику в 30%, или использовать одно из50 бесплатных кодов погашения в App Store.

0 голосов
/ 10 октября 2011

Зависит от того, как вы хотите его настроить.

Если у вас есть UDID, вы можете проверить его в коде, подобном следующему:

NSString *udid = [[UIDevice currentDevice] uniqueIdentifier];

Оттуда вы можете просто переключать графику или функциональность в зависимости от того, соответствует устройство UDID или нет.

Примечание: uniqueIdentifier устарела с iOS5. Это все еще работает и может все еще работать хорошо в будущем, но нет никакой гарантии этого.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...